Materials:
- Tongue depressor for each puppet
- Pencil
- Pen or fine tip marker
- Colored markers
- Some options: paper, wiggle eyes, felt, pompoms, and
yarn
- Need with options white glue and scissors
Directions:
Lightly draw a character on tongue depressor. Keep
drawing simple, you can add more details later with a
pen. For character ideas, you might want to draw
family members or favorite characters from books or
movies. Color in your drawing with markers. Use pen or
fine tip marker to add small details such as buttons,
eyes or other facial features. For a more creative
effect you can use scraps of felt or paper to add body
parts such as wings, tail ears, or yarn for hair.
You can use wiggle eyes, sequins, pompoms; and buttons can be glued on
for eyes. Let glue dry
completely before playing with puppet.
